Our industry recognized and ranked Asia Fintech Practice has a strong reputation for assisting clients (particularly in the financial services sector) to navigate through regulatory hurdles in Asia involving the use of emerging technologies (including Web3 / blockchain, artificial intelligence and big data projects), and crafting novel arrangements for the implementation of such technologies.
The lawyers in our Asia practice can help you with all areas of fintech law. Our key experience includes advising:
- seven banks in Hong Kong to launch a DLT-based trade finance platform coordinated by the Hong Kong Monetary Authority. The platform will facilitate trades and arrangement of financing through sharing information between customers and banks in the platform
- a global financial institution on its partnership with a leading fintech firm in Mainland China in relation to the launch of intra-group treasury management and payment processing platform
- a leading “banking-as-a-service” technology solutions provider on the licensing of its core banking platform to numerous financial institutions and virtual banks
- a global bank in Hong Kong in relation to its first “open API” arrangement as part of the Hong Kong Monetary Authority’s Open API Framework
- a regional bank in Hong Kong in relation to multiple strategic APIs with large multinationals in Hong Kong
- a global digital payment platform company in respect of its virtual corporate card products with international card schemes
